sl1234 Posted August 31, 2006 Report Share Posted August 31, 2006 I just installed the Pioneer camera to the Z1. It worked perfect for a couple of days. Now I started getting a distorted dim picture on ocassion. So far it happened twice. Otherwise, the picture is perfect. It doesn't happen all the time so I can't troubleshoot it to determine if it is the Z1 or the camera. Has anybody had this problem before? Would a hard reset of the Z1 help? sl1234 Posted August 31, 2006 Author Report Share Posted August 31, 2006 I opened the dash to check on the video connection and it was secured. When I checked on the connector going into the Z1, I heard click sound which probably meant that the connection was not plugged in al the way. I connected my camcorder to the camera input of the Z1 and it was ok. I hope the loose connection was the problem of the intermittent distortion. Quote Link to post Share on other sites
